Xi'an Famous Foods offers a genuine taste of authentic Xi'an cuisine with its hand-pulled noodles and flavorful dishes. The restaurant is celebrated for its high-quality, freshly made food, although some customers have noted minor inconsistencies in service and atmosphere across locations.
